Summary
Greg Gates is a seasoned technology executive with a rich background in fintech and software publishing. As the Managing Director and Chief Technology & Information Officer at LPL Financial, he leads transformative initiatives that enhance advisor and investor experiences. His career spans notable companies like PayPal and Bank of America, where he developed a strong expertise in product management, enterprise strategy, and agile delivery. Greg is recognized for his ability to drive change through innovative technology solutions and servant leadership. He champions diversity and inclusion within his teams, focusing on developing the next generation of leaders. With a data-driven approach, he consistently delivers transformational results and fosters high-performing teams. Greg's educational background in Biomedical Engineering from Vanderbilt University complements his extensive professional experience in technology and management.
